I'm building a Storyline course for a client (we'll call Client A) who is producing the course for another client (Client B). Client B is using Review to provide feedback on the course. Is it possible for Client A to visually "green light/red light" the changes Client B is suggesting before I make them? Is is possible for me and Client A to make comments to Client B's comments without Client B being able to see them? If this type of functionality is not (yet?) available in Review, has anyone developed their own process for vetting comments made in Review before taking action on them?

Oh, good idea Tristan! The email comments would only appear to Client A if Client B was commenting on something that Client A was mentioned on/tagged in. Otherwise if everyone is commenting on the same file, you as the author/owner of the Review course would get the email notifications and no one else. 

If you're at all concerned Chris, I'd look at publishing it a second time just so that if you do tag someone they're not included in all the subsequent comments.
